Harry Potter
4,630 results
$22.50 - $27.27
Select items on sale
$17.99 - $18.99
reg $29.99
Sale
$18.99 - $29.99
reg $29.99 - $31.99
Sale
$18.99
reg $29.99
Sale
$19.99
reg $24.99
Sale
$26.66 - $33.37
Select items on sale
$16.19 - $24.71
Select items on sale
$11.99 - $14.99
Select items on sale
$17.99 - $18.99
reg $29.99
Sale
$17.99 - $19.99
Select items on sale